Mann in Mumbai to woo investors
Chandigarh, Feb. 4 -- Chief minister Bhagwant Mann on Tuesday held a series of meetings with industry leaders in Mumbai as part of the state government's efforts to boost investment in Punjab.
According to the official statement issued by the government, Mumbai-based Hinduja group, which has diversified business interests, has signalled interest in investing in the state.
Presenting Punjab as a stable, future-ready and business-friendly destination, Mann said that the state has received investment proposals worth Rs.1.5 lakh crore since March 2022 in the fields of electric mobility to digital services.
Elaborating on the opportunities available, Mann said that the state offers immense scope for investment in sectors such as electric vehicles, financial and digital services, cyber security, renewable energy, healthcare, industrial and real estate collaboration. "Punjab has traditionally played a vital role in ensuring the country's food security. The state's industrial journey has now taken a dynamic turn. Today, Punjab is an industrial powerhouse, leading in sectors such as food processing, textiles, auto components, hand tools, bicycles, information technology, tourism and others," the CM said while interacting with the top executives of the Hinduja group.
The investment proposals have the potential to create over 5.3 lakh jobs, the CM added.
Highlighting the confidence reposed by global corporations, the CM said that Punjab is home to prestigious international companies including Nestle, Claas, Freudenberg, Cargill, Verbio and Danone, all of which have established operations here, contributing to economic transformation, adding that the state's global reach is evident through investments from countries such as Japan, the United States of America, Germany, the United Kingdom, the United Arab Emirates, Switzerland, France, Spain and others.
